+// Default initial value for HTTP/2 SETTINGS. |
+const uint32_t kDefaultInitialHeaderTableSize = 4096; |
+const uint32_t kDefaultInitialEnablePush = 1; |
+const uint32_t kDefaultInitialInitialWindowSize = 65535; |
+const uint32_t kDefaultInitialMaxFrameSize = 16384; |
+ |
+bool IsSpdySettingAtDefaultInitialValue(SpdySettingsIds setting_id, |
+ uint32_t value) { |
+ switch (setting_id) { |
+ case SETTINGS_HEADER_TABLE_SIZE: |
+ return value == kDefaultInitialHeaderTableSize; |
+ case SETTINGS_ENABLE_PUSH: |
+ return value == kDefaultInitialEnablePush; |
+ case SETTINGS_MAX_CONCURRENT_STREAMS: |
+ // There is no initial limit on the number of concurrent streams. |
+ return false; |
+ case SETTINGS_INITIAL_WINDOW_SIZE: |
+ return value == kDefaultInitialInitialWindowSize; |
+ case SETTINGS_MAX_FRAME_SIZE: |
+ return value == kDefaultInitialMaxFrameSize; |
+ case SETTINGS_MAX_HEADER_LIST_SIZE: |
+ // There is no initial limit on the size of the header list. |
+ return false; |
+ default: |
+ // Undefined parameters have no initial value. |
+ return false; |
+ } |
+} |
